Bennett Muñoz Moreau, LCSW, CSWA (Oregon)

As a therapist I focus on creating a space where clients feel comfortable, supported, and heard. My focus is to meet you exactly where you are—without judgment—and help you move towards your goals.  My approach is client-centered, holistic, and trauma-informed, meaning that you guide the process and your story is always at the center of our work together. I’m honored to walk alongside clients as they build insight, resilience, and self-compassion.

I’ve been in the field of social work since 2016, after graduating from Boise State University with a deep interest in how people grow, heal, and connect. Since then, I’ve had the privilege of supporting individuals across inpatient, outpatient, and telehealth settings. My experience has taught me more than techniques; it taught me to look at the whole person. I support individuals experiencing stress, anxiety, depression, trauma, ADHD, and neurodivergence, with an approach that honors both your lived experience and your inner strengths.
